Output 639204af56699237585fb99d69fe655026cc12da11344b20874c3780e466f1e4:9

value
95759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ba1ff652a95502fdf54144409f0b415bfa15866 OP_EQUAL
address
35fj3avLZepner92urEP3QpaejqTf8XZq3
transaction
639204af56699237585fb99d69fe655026cc12da11344b20874c3780e466f1e4
spent
true